#a4ec94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a4ec94 is composed of 64.3% red, 92.5%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.3%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 109.1 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 75.3%. #a4ec94 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#49d929.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

● #a4ec94 color description : Very soft lime green.
#a4ec94 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a4ec94 has RGB values of R:164, G:236,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 10808468.

Shades and Tints of #a4ec94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a02 is the darkest color, while #f9f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a4ec94
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c0c0c0 is the less saturated color, while #9bfb85 is the most saturated one.
